Get onto Cyberpaddock.

Cyberpaddock is the on line voting system that professional performing arts venues across Australia use to select performing arts product for their program of events.

If you would like to get your show onto Cyberpaddock, contact the Touring Manager at Country Arts WA who can assist you to develop an online entry.

If you run a venue in regional WA and would like to check out what's on offer from around the nation, talk to the Touring Manager about how to lodge votes online.

Blue Heeler's National Touring Network

Country Arts WA is the West Australian representative of the 'Blue Heeler' National Touring Network - the main body supporting, facilitating and coordinating national performing arts touring in Australia.

Country Arts WA works within the Blue Heeler National Touring Network to provide opportunities for WA producers and to meet the needs and expectations of regional presenters and audiences.

The Blue Heelers administer the Cyberpaddock website and also coordinate the biannual Long Paddock touring forums, a showcase of productions short-listed from the voting on the Cyberpaddock website. Producers invited to attend Long Paddock are usually in running to get a further boost to their prospects for national touring through funding from Playing Australia, the Commonwealth Government’s national performing arts touring program. Country Arts WA assists WA producers whose show has attracted considerable national interest in developing a funding application to Playing Australia. Country Arts WA also coordinates the national touring of successful applications to Playing Australia.

In 2008 Country Arts WA will tour productions of the WA Ballet, Perth Theatre Company and Spare Parts Puppet Theatre to venues outside of WA.
